Directions
- Combine cream-style corn, regular corn, eggs, half-and-half, cream, flour, cornmeal, sugar, melted butter, salt, and pepper in a 2-1/2 to 3-quart casserole.
- Bake at 325 to 350 degrees F (165 to 175 degrees C) for 1 hour, or until set.
